
Ingredients
-
1 (6.5 ounce) jar oil-packed tuna, drained
-
2 tablespoons finely diced celery
-
1 tablespoon minced green onion
-
2 teaspoons capers, drained
-
2 tablespoons mayonnaise, or more to taste
-
1 teaspoon Asian chile paste (such as sambal oelek)
-
⅓ cup fresh mozzarella cheese
-
salt and ground black pepper to taste
-
2 tablespoons softened butter, divided
-
2 thick slices French bread
-
¼ cup shredded sharp white Cheddar cheese, divided
-
1 pinch cayenne pepper, or to taste
Directions
-
Place tuna into a mixing bowl and lightly break it apart with a fork. Add celery, green onion, capers, mayonnaise, and chile paste. Pinch in small pieces mozzarella and stir to mix. Season with salt and black pepper; refrigerate tuna salad until needed.
-
Preheat the oven's broiler.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il.
-
Spread butter generously on both sides of French bread slices.
-
Broil buttered bread until golden brown on top, 2 to 3 minutes. Flip bread slices and broil other side until toasted, 2 to 3 more minutes. Remove from the oven and turn bread slices over on the baking sheet so the darkest sides are on the bottom.
-
Gently spread tuna salad onto bread slices using 2 forks. Press the salad onto the bread and spread tuna all the way to the edges of the bread. Spread shredded Cheddar over each sandwich. Dust tops with cayenne pepper.
-
Place sandwiches under the broiler and cook until cheese is melted and bubbling, 5 to 6 minutes.

Recipe Tip
You can place a baking dish underneath your sheet pan if you need to move your food closer to the broiler flame.
